Skip to content

Commit 4a54cad

Browse files
Merge pull request #938 from commercetools/gen-sdk-updates
Update generated SDKs
2 parents bfe38fc + 30577d1 commit 4a54cad

File tree

530 files changed

+6951
-3318
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

530 files changed

+6951
-3318
lines changed

changes.md

Lines changed: 38 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-214,6 +214,13 @@
214214

215215
**Import changes**
216216

217+
<details>
218+
<summary>Added Enum(s)</summary>
219+
220+
- added enum `product-selection` to type `ImportResourceType`
221+
</details>
222+
223+
217224
<details>
218225
<summary>Added Property(s)</summary>
219226

@@ -226,14 +233,45 @@
226233
</details>
227234

228235

236+
<details>
237+
<summary>Changed Property(s)</summary>
238+
239+
- :warning: changed property `country` of type `ExternalTaxRateDraft` from type `string` to `CountryCode`
240+
- :warning: changed property `value` of type `MoneySetField` from type `Money[]` to `TypedMoney[]`
241+
</details>
242+
243+
244+
<details>
245+
<summary>Added Method(s)</summary>
246+
247+
- added method `apiRoot.withProjectKeyValue().productSelections().importContainers().withImportContainerKeyValue().post()`
248+
</details>
249+
250+
229251
<details>
230252
<summary>Added Type(s)</summary>
231253

232254
- added type `StrategyEnum`
233255
- added type `RetentionPolicy`
234256
- added type `TimeToLiveConfig`
235257
- added type `TimeToLiveRetentionPolicy`
258+
- added type `ProductSelectionImportRequest`
236259
- added type `AttributeLevel`
260+
- added type `VariantSelectionType`
261+
- added type `VariantSelection`
262+
- added type `VariantExclusion`
263+
- added type `ProductSelectionAssignment`
264+
- added type `ProductSelectionMode`
265+
- added type `ProductSelectionImport`
266+
</details>
267+
268+
269+
<details>
270+
<summary>Added Resource(s)</summary>
271+
272+
- added resource `/{projectKey}/product-selections`
273+
- added resource `/{projectKey}/product-selections/import-containers`
274+
- added resource `/{projectKey}/product-selections/import-containers/{importContainerKey}`
237275
</details>
238276

239277
**History changes**

commercetools/commercetools-sdk-java-api/src/main/java-generated/com/commercetools/api/models/common/Asset.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-37,7 +37,7 @@
3737
public interface Asset extends com.commercetools.api.models.Customizable<Asset>, com.commercetools.api.models.WithKey {
3838

3939
/**
40-
* <p>Unique identifier of the Asset.</p>
40+
* <p>Unique identifier of the Asset. Not required when importing Assets using the Import API.</p>
4141
* @return id
4242
*/
4343
@NotNull
@@ -95,7 +95,7 @@ public interface Asset extends com.commercetools.api.models.Customizable<Asset>,
9595
public String getKey();
9696

9797
/**
98-
* <p>Unique identifier of the Asset.</p>
98+
* <p>Unique identifier of the Asset. Not required when importing Assets using the Import API.</p>
9999
* @param id value to be set
100100
*/
101101

commercetools/commercetools-sdk-java-api/src/main/java-generated/com/commercetools/api/models/common/AssetBuilder.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-45,7 +45,7 @@ public class AssetBuilder implements Builder<Asset> {
4545
private String key;
4646

4747
/**
48-
* <p>Unique identifier of the Asset.</p>
48+
* <p>Unique identifier of the Asset. Not required when importing Assets using the Import API.</p>
4949
* @param id value to be set
5050
* @return Builder
5151
*/
@@ -294,7 +294,7 @@ public AssetBuilder key(@Nullable final String key) {
294294
}
295295

296296
/**
297-
* <p>Unique identifier of the Asset.</p>
297+
* <p>Unique identifier of the Asset. Not required when importing Assets using the Import API.</p>
298298
* @return id
299299
*/
300300

commercetools/commercetools-sdk-java-api/src/main/java-generated/com/commercetools/api/models/common/AssetImpl.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-63,7 +63,7 @@ public AssetImpl() {
6363
}
6464

6565
/**
66-
* <p>Unique identifier of the Asset.</p>
66+
* <p>Unique identifier of the Asset. Not required when importing Assets using the Import API.</p>
6767
*/
6868

6969
public String getId() {

commercetools/commercetools-sdk-java-api/src/main/java-generated/com/commercetools/api/models/me/MyPaymentDraft.java

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,8 @@
11

22
package com.commercetools.api.models.me;
33

4+
import java.time.*;
5+
import java.util.*;
46
import java.util.function.Function;
57

68
import javax.annotation.Nullable;

commercetools/commercetools-sdk-java-importapi/src/main/java-generated/com/commercetools/importapi/client/ByProjectKeyCategoriesImportContainersByImportContainerKeyPost.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@
1616
import org.apache.commons.lang3.builder.HashCodeBuilder;
1717

1818
/**
19-
* <p>Creates a request for creating new Categories or updating existing ones.</p>
19+
* <p>Creates an Import Request for Categories.</p>
2020
*
2121
* <hr>
2222
* <div class=code-example>

commercetools/commercetools-sdk-java-importapi/src/main/java-generated/com/commercetools/importapi/client/ByProjectKeyCategoriesImportContainersByImportContainerKeyPostString.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@
1717
import org.apache.commons.lang3.builder.HashCodeBuilder;
1818

1919
/**
20-
* <p>Creates a request for creating new Categories or updating existing ones.</p>
20+
* <p>Creates an Import Request for Categories.</p>
2121
*
2222
* <hr>
2323
* <div class=code-example>

commercetools/commercetools-sdk-java-importapi/src/main/java-generated/com/commercetools/importapi/client/ByProjectKeyCustomersImportContainersByImportContainerKeyPost.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@
1616
import org.apache.commons.lang3.builder.HashCodeBuilder;
1717

1818
/**
19-
* <p>Creates a request for creating new Customers or updating existing ones.</p>
19+
* <p>Creates an Import Request for Customers.</p>
2020
*
2121
* <hr>
2222
* <div class=code-example>

commercetools/commercetools-sdk-java-importapi/src/main/java-generated/com/commercetools/importapi/client/ByProjectKeyCustomersImportContainersByImportContainerKeyPostString.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@
1717
import org.apache.commons.lang3.builder.HashCodeBuilder;
1818

1919
/**
20-
* <p>Creates a request for creating new Customers or updating existing ones.</p>
20+
* <p>Creates an Import Request for Customers.</p>
2121
*
2222
* <hr>
2323
* <div class=code-example>

commercetools/commercetools-sdk-java-importapi/src/main/java-generated/com/commercetools/importapi/client/ByProjectKeyDiscountCodesImportContainersByImportContainerKeyPost.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@
1616
import org.apache.commons.lang3.builder.HashCodeBuilder;
1717

1818
/**
19-
* <p>Creates a request for creating new Discount Codes or updating existing ones.</p>
19+
* <p>Creates an Import Request for Discount Codes.</p>
2020
*
2121
* <hr>
2222
* <div class=code-example>

0 commit comments

Comments
 (0)